Today, on my birthday, I decided to bird on our property in Gilroy.
When I pulled up beside the water tanks, I heard a distinctive
sharpish, loud whistle, which to my untrained ear sounded like an
upturned twit, repeated about 2 per second over and over with
occasional pauses.

That vocal description sounds like Hutton's Vireo.  Did you hear it do
anything else?
